Apple Watch Ultra 3 vs Ultra 2

Disclosure: GadgetShowdown may earn from qualifying purchases via affiliate links.Learn more

Quick Answer

Apple Watch Ultra 3 (September 2025) brings S10 chip, 42-hour battery (up from 36h), and third-generation sensors versus Ultra 2's S9 and 36-hour battery. Both share 49mm titanium case, 3,000-nit LTPO3 display, Action Button, and satellite connectivity. This is an incremental year-over-year update. Ultra 3 is the pick for new buyers; Ultra 2 becomes attractive when discounted $100 or more.

Spec Comparison

Spec Ultra 3 Ultra 2
Case size 49mm Grade 5 titanium 49mm Grade 5 titanium
Display 422×514 px, LTPO3, 3,000 nits 422×514 px, LTPO3, 3,000 nits
Chip S10 SiP S9 SiP
Storage 64GB 64GB
Battery (normal use) Up to 42 hours Up to 36 hours
Battery (Low Power) Up to 72 hours Up to 72 hours
Extended Workout Up to 20 hours Up to 20 hours
Fast charging 15 min = 12h use 15 min = 8h use
Weight 61.6g (natural titanium) 61.4g (natural titanium)
Heart rate sensors Third-gen optical + electrical Third-gen optical + electrical
Satellite connectivity Emergency SOS, Messages, Find My Emergency SOS, Messages, Find My
GPS Dual-frequency (L1+L5) Dual-frequency (L1+L5)
Water/Dive rating 100m / 40m dive 100m / 40m dive
Operating system watchOS 26 (upgradable to 27) watchOS 26 (upgradable to 27)
Price (US launch) $799 $799 (2024 launch)

The incremental upgrade

Ultra 3 refines Ultra 2 rather than revolutionizing it. The S10 chip brings efficiency improvements that enable 42 hours of battery (up from 36), and fast charging sees improvement (12h from 15 min vs 8h).

Battery life improvement

Six additional hours may not sound dramatic, but it’s the difference between needing to charge on day two versus making it through comfortably. For weekend adventurers, Ultra 3’s battery is more forgiving.

Fast charging improvement

Ultra 3’s improved fast charging (12 hours from 15 minutes versus 8 hours on Ultra 2) makes quick top-ups more practical before heading out.

Identical core features

Both watches share the 3,000-nit display, Action Button, satellite connectivity (Emergency SOS, messaging, Find My), dual-frequency GPS, 100m water resistance, and 40m dive certification.

Software support

Both run watchOS 27. Ultra 3 will receive updates for approximately one additional year compared to Ultra 2, but both have years of support remaining.

Price and value

At full price, Ultra 3 is the better choice for the battery improvement. Ultra 2 becomes compelling when street prices drop to $699 or below — saving $100+ makes the 6-hour battery difference easier to accept.

Is Ultra 3 worth upgrading from Ultra 2?

For most Ultra 2 owners, no. The improvements are incremental: S10 chip, 6 more hours of battery, and updated sensors. Wait for Ultra 4's larger generational leap unless battery life is critical.

What did S10 chip add over S9?

S10 brings modest performance improvements and efficiency gains that enable the extended battery life. Both chips are fast for daily use; the difference is evolutionary, not revolutionary.

Do both support satellite connectivity?

Yes, both Ultra 2 and Ultra 3 include Emergency SOS via satellite, satellite messaging, and Find My via satellite.
